Borussia Dortmund defender Mats Hummels, who is set to become a free agent this summer, has emerged as a target for Serie A giants Milan. Despite being controversially left out of the German national team squad for Euro 2024 and announcing that he will not be renewing his contract with his current club, Hummels is reportedly eager to join Milan.

According to reports from Il Messaggero, Milan are keen on bringing the former World Cup winner to their team. However, there were conflicting reports suggesting that Hummels was considering a move to La Liga to join Mallorca instead. However, Hummels’ agent has since clarified that the player was simply visiting Mallorca for a family holiday and not for transfer negotiations.

After an impressive season with Dortmund, where he helped the team reach the Champions League Final, Hummels is reportedly seeking one final challenge before retiring from professional football. With other clubs in Europe also interested in securing his services for the upcoming season, it remains to be seen where the experienced defender will end up.
